        "text": "AI visibility monitoring should be tightly scoped around questions your buyers and users actually ask, not abstract prompts. The more realistic your prompt set, the more reliable your insights.\n\nYou want to mirror real search intent: informational, comparison, and “best X” queries that map to your funnel.\n\n**Key factors:**\n- Use search term reports, customer support tickets, and sales notes\n- Include informational, problem-aware, and comparison questions\n- Capture both branded and non-branded prompts\n- Group prompts by funnel stage and use case\n\nStart by exporting search terms or listing the top questions people ask your team, then rewrite them in natural language the way they’d be typed into an AI assistant at night on a phone. Cluster prompts by themes and buyer stage so you can see where you’re strong or weak. Avoid generic, unrealistic prompts that people would never ask.\n\nTeams that build prompt sets from real behavior instead of guesses get far more actionable visibility data.",
